欢迎光临
我们一直在努力

pbootcms后台自定义字段多图上传 不能多图拖动解决办法

修改\apps\admin\view\default\content\content.html底部拖动js代码。

<script type="text/javascript">

/*
$("#pics_box").dragsort({
    dragSelector: "dl",
    dragSelectorExclude: "input,textarea,dd",
    dragBetween: false,
    dragEnd: saveOrder,
    placeHolderTemplate: "<dl class='placeHolder'><dt></dt></dl>"
});



function saveOrder() {
    var data = $("#pics_box dl dt img").map(function() {
        return $(this).data("url");
    }).get();
    $("input[name=pics]").val(data.join(","))
};

*/

// 定义一个通用的拖动排序函数 AB模板网 www.adminbuy.cn
function setupDragSort(boxId, inputName) {
    $(`#${boxId}`).dragsort({
        dragSelector: "dl",
        dragSelectorExclude: "input,textarea,dd",
        dragBetween: false,
        dragEnd: function() {
            saveOrder(boxId, inputName);
        },
        placeHolderTemplate: "<dl class='placeHolder'><dt></dt></dl>"
    });
}

// 定义保存排序结果的函数
function saveOrder(boxId, inputName) {
    var data = $(`#${boxId} dl dt img`).map(function() {
        return $(this).data("url");
    }).get();
    $(`input[name=${inputName}]`).val(data.join(","));
}

// 初始化每个元素的拖动排序功能
setupDragSort("pics_box", "pics");
setupDragSort("ext_yszp_box", "ext_yszp");
setupDragSort("ext_xiaogutu_box", "ext_xiaogutu");
setupDragSort("ext_caipingtu_box", "ext_caipingtu");
setupDragSort("ext_wangongtu_box", "ext_wangongtu");
</script>

 

赞(0) 打赏
未经允许不得转载:新起点博客 » pbootcms后台自定义字段多图上传 不能多图拖动解决办法
分享到: 更多 (0)

评论 抢沙发

评论前必须登录!

 

觉得文章有用就打赏一下文章作者

非常感谢你的打赏,我们将继续给力更多优质内容,让我们一起创建更加美好的网络世界!

支付宝扫一扫打赏

微信扫一扫打赏